Exhibition of Spain's '7 Lions' at Bonalba Sports Complex

The Spanish rugby sevens team, world runners-up, offers an open training session to the public this Friday at the Mutxamel sports complex

Spain's Men's Rugby Sevens team, having recently achieved a historic feat by becoming world runners-up in Madrid, arrives in Alicante province this week to prepare for their upcoming international commitments.

The team, which has earned international respect by defeating powerhouses like New Zealand, South Africa, and Argentina, will hold an open training session this Friday, June 6, from 11 am to 1 pm at the Bonalba Sports Complex in Mutxamel. This is a unique opportunity to see some of the best players of the moment up close and experience firsthand the intensity and spirit of a team that has defied all odds.

Spanish rugby is experiencing an unstoppable growth phase. At the level of clubs, regional federations, and national competitions, a solid foundation has been established that feeds both the youth and senior national teams. The progressive professionalisation of the sport, institutional support, and increasing media coverage have been key to Spain becoming an emerging reference in international rugby. The numbers speak for themselves: the number of licenses has increased over the last decade, schools and grassroots rugby programs have multiplied, and national teams have begun to achieve historic results in both men's and women's categories.

Bonalba Golf Resort, which was the venue last April for the International Test Match between Spain and South Africa's women's teams, once again hosts the national teams due to the quality of its facilities, its strategic location, and the environment it offers for high-level training camps. In the coming days, the women's XV team, the 'Leonas', and the Under-20 team will also arrive to train, preparing for important international events such as the World Cup in Italy or the tour in Japan.

This Friday, the session will be open to all those who wish to come and see firsthand the work of a team that is making history. It is a unique opportunity to discover the intensity, tactics, and values of a sport that is winning over more people every day.
